O que é: Table-Based Indexing (Indexação Baseada em Tabela)

O que é Table-Based Indexing (Indexação Baseada em Tabela)

Table-Based Indexing, ou Indexação Baseada em Tabela, é um método utilizado em bancos de dados para organizar e acessar informações de forma eficiente. Neste sistema, os dados são armazenados em tabelas, onde cada linha representa um registro e cada coluna representa um atributo do registro.

Como funciona a Table-Based Indexing

Na Indexação Baseada em Tabela, são criados índices que apontam para as posições dos registros na tabela. Esses índices facilitam a busca e recuperação de dados, tornando as operações mais rápidas e eficientes. Além disso, a indexação baseada em tabela permite a ordenação dos registros de acordo com um ou mais atributos, o que facilita a consulta e análise dos dados.

Vantagens da Table-Based Indexing

Uma das principais vantagens da Indexação Baseada em Tabela é a melhoria no desempenho das consultas. Com os índices criados, as buscas são mais rápidas e eficientes, pois o sistema consegue localizar os registros de forma mais rápida. Além disso, a indexação baseada em tabela facilita a manutenção e atualização dos dados, garantindo a integridade e consistência das informações.

Desvantagens da Table-Based Indexing

Apesar das vantagens, a Indexação Baseada em Tabela também apresenta algumas desvantagens. Uma delas é o aumento no tamanho do banco de dados, uma vez que os índices ocupam espaço de armazenamento. Além disso, a criação e manutenção dos índices podem demandar recursos computacionais, o que pode impactar no desempenho do sistema em determinadas situações.

Aplicações da Table-Based Indexing

A Indexação Baseada em Tabela é amplamente utilizada em sistemas de gerenciamento de bancos de dados relacionais, como MySQL, Oracle e SQL Server. Esses sistemas utilizam a indexação baseada em tabela para otimizar as consultas e garantir a eficiência na recuperação de dados. Além disso, a indexação baseada em tabela também é aplicada em sistemas de busca na web, onde a velocidade e precisão na recuperação de informações são essenciais.

Conclusão

Em resumo, a Table-Based Indexing, ou Indexação Baseada em Tabela, é um método eficiente e poderoso para organizar e acessar informações em bancos de dados. Com a criação de índices e a ordenação dos registros, a indexação baseada em tabela melhora o desempenho das consultas e facilita a recuperação de dados. Apesar de algumas desvantagens, como o aumento no tamanho do banco de dados, a indexação baseada em tabela é amplamente utilizada em diversos sistemas e aplicações, contribuindo para a eficiência e rapidez na manipulação de informações.

Botão Voltar ao Topo